Stubby Kaye (November 11, 1918 – December 14, 1997) born as Bernard Katzin was an American comic actor known for his appearances in film musicals.
Biography
Kaye was born Bernard Katzin in New York City on the last day of the First World War, at West 114th Street in the Morningside Heights section of Manhattan to first generation Jewish-Americans originally from Russia and Austria. He was raised in the Far Rockaway section of Queens and in The Bronx.
His first wife was Jeanne Watson from Chicago, who was a clerical worker at the movie studios in the late 1950s. They were married in 1960 as the series Love and Marriage ended, but the couple divorced because of personal differences within a year of their marriage.
Kaye's second wife, Angela Bracewell, was a former dancer at the London Palladium whom he met while living in Great Britain. She was the hostess of the British version of the Beat the Clock game show, a segment of Val Parnell's Sunday Night at the London Palladium. They remained married until his death.
